OverviewA stunning set of notebooks for journaling, sketching, and brainstorming, from Flow, the brand that celebrates creativity, mindfulness, and the pleasures of paper. Includes: Set of 3 notebooks: 1 graph paper notebook, 1 dot grid notebook, and 1 ruled notebook Textured covers with 3 different designs and foil stamping 64 pages each Printed on FSC-certified paper This set of three elegantly designed notebooks, inspired by the Henry David Thoreau quotation “All good things are wild and free,” suits all of your creative needs. All Good Things helps you work through bright ideas; Wild allows you to release your thoughts on paper; and Free encourages you to let go and reach your goals. The full All Good Things Are Wild and Free stationery line includes: 1000-piece jigsaw puzzle, sticker book, stationery set, daily tracker, wrapping paper and gift tags, sticky notes, sketchbook, and notebook set.
